Edo State House of Assembly Speaker's Thuggery: A Threat to Democracy and the Electoral Process-Dr. Eholor

 


In a shocking display of political intimidation, the campaign train of Olumide Akpata was met with violent opposition in Ward 2 Uhomora as thugs allegedly sent by the Speaker of the Edo State House of Assembly attempted to disrupt the peaceful political gathering. This blatant attempt to stifle the democratic process and prevent political opponents from campaigning is a stark reminder of the challenges that continue to plague Nigeria's political landscape.


As a society that values the principles of democracy and the rule of law, we must strongly condemn these acts of political thuggery and call on the relevant authorities to take swift action against the perpetrators.


 Furthermore, we urge the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) to investigate this matter and ensure that all political parties are held accountable for their actions.



Section 94(1) of the Electoral Act 2022 stipulates that "A political campaign or slogan shall not be tainted with abusive language directly or indirectly likely to injure religious, ethnic, tribal or sectional feelings." Additionally, Section 92(3) states that "Places designated for religious worship, police stations and public offices shall not be used for political campaigns, rallies and processions; or to promote, propagate or attack political parties, candidates or their programmes or ideologies."


As we approach the upcoming elections, it is crucial that political leaders and their supporters adhere to the provisions of the Electoral Act and respect the rights of all citizens to participate in the democratic process without fear of intimidation or violence. We must send a strong message that thuggery and political malfeasance will not be tolerated in our democratic system.


In conclusion, we call on the Edo State House of Assembly Speaker, the councillor involved in this incident, and all political parties to recommit themselves to the principles of democracy, transparency, and the rule of law. Only by holding our leaders accountable and ensuring a fair and equitable electoral process can we build a stronger, more united Nigeria for generations to come.
